Common Questions About Summer Activities Austin
Q: How can I enjoy outdoor summer events without high costs? Many summer activities in Austin are free or low-cost, including public concerts, pop-up art markets, and community-driven gatherings. Weekly events often offer visitors discounted wristbands or timed entry for manageable, affordable participation.
Q: Is Austin safe during the summer months? Austin maintains strong public safety protocols, with increased visibility during peak seasons. Major events emphasize community safety, with clearly marked access, staffed information points, and responsible crowd management essential to a welcoming experience.
Q: Where are the best spots for families with kids? Zilker Park remains a top family destination, offering pools, open fields, shaded pavilions, and frequent kid-friendly programs.
